Details About Iwo Jima

Destinations » Asia » China - Japan - Korea » Iwo Jima


Iwo Jima is a volcanic island in Japan, part of the Volcano Islands (the southern part of the Ogasawara Islands). It is famous as the site of the Battle of Iwo Jima in February and March, 1945, between the United States and Japan during World War II. Iwo Jima was occupied by the U.S. until 1968, when it was returned to Japan.
